This SVG file is a digital representation of a BBQ grill, designed for various uses in crafting and DIY projects. The vector art can be used to create custom designs for personal or commercial purposes.

The design features detailed elements that can be customized using a variety of software programs, such as Illustrator or Procreate, allowing users to personalize the image to fit their specific needs. It can be scaled up or down without losing any quality, making it suitable for various applications.

For crafting and DIY enthusiasts, this file can be used in conjunction with cutting machines like Cricut or a silhouette machine, or even laser cutters, to create custom stencils or templates for pyrography projects. It's also compatible with web design software, enabling users to incorporate the image into their website designs.

When using this SVG file, it's recommended to adjust the settings according to the desired output. For instance, if printing a large version on paper, ensure the resolution is high enough to produce crisp details. On the other hand, when using it for web design or smaller applications, reducing the resolution may be necessary to maintain optimal performance.

As for suggestions on materials that can be used with this file, users have various options depending on their intended project. For instance, iron-on vinyl can be used to create custom decals, while cardstock and paper are suitable for crafting stencils.
